How to Diagnose Bronchiolitis
Bronchiolitis is diagnosed clinically based on history and physical examination alone—do not routinely order chest radiographs, viral testing, or laboratory studies. 1, 2
Clinical Diagnostic Criteria
The diagnosis requires identifying a characteristic pattern in children younger than 2 years of age:
- Viral upper respiratory prodrome (rhinorrhea, congestion) followed by progression to lower respiratory tract symptoms 1, 2
- Lower respiratory signs including cough, tachypnea, wheezing or crackles on auscultation 1
- Increased work of breathing manifested as grunting, nasal flaring, intercostal and/or subcostal retractions 1
The physical examination should focus on respiratory rate (count over a full minute), presence of retractions, and auscultatory findings rather than relying on ancillary testing 1, 2.
Critical Risk Stratification
Immediately assess for high-risk factors that predict severe disease: 1, 2
- Age less than 12 weeks
- History of prematurity (less than 37 weeks gestation)
- Hemodynamically significant congenital heart disease
- Chronic lung disease (bronchopulmonary dysplasia)
- Immunodeficiency or immunocompromised state
These infants require closer monitoring and have different management thresholds, as they are at increased risk for progression to severe disease, ICU admission, or mechanical ventilation 1.
Severity Assessment Parameters
Evaluate the following to determine disease severity and need for hospitalization: 1, 2
- Respiratory rate: Tachypnea ≥70 breaths/minute indicates increased severity risk 1, 2
- Oxygen saturation: Check if SpO₂ persistently falls below 90% 2
- Feeding ability: Assess for decreased intake or difficulty feeding 2
- Hydration status: Look for signs of dehydration 1
- Mental status changes or presence of apnea 1
Young infants with bronchiolitis may develop apnea, which has been associated with increased risk for prolonged hospitalization and intensive care 1.
What NOT to Do
Avoid routine diagnostic testing—it does not improve outcomes and leads to unnecessary interventions: 1, 2
- No routine chest radiographs: Approximately 25% of hospitalized infants have atelectasis or infiltrates commonly misinterpreted as bacterial pneumonia, leading to unnecessary antibiotic use 2
- No routine viral testing unless needed for infection control purposes 1, 2
- No routine laboratory studies unless specific concerns for bacterial coinfection exist 1, 2
The absence of tachypnea correlates with lack of lower respiratory tract infection, making clinical assessment more valuable than imaging 1.
Important Differential Considerations
While bronchiolitis is a clinical diagnosis, remain alert to: 2
- Bacterial pneumonia with consolidation (though routine chest X-rays are not recommended to exclude this)
- Acute otitis media (occurs in 50-62% of cases and should be managed per standard otitis media guidelines when identified)
- Serious bacterial infection in febrile infants less than 28 days old (approximately 10% risk—these infants require evaluation per standard fever protocols)
Common Pitfalls to Avoid
- Do not diagnose based on age cutoffs alone—the clinical presentation (viral prodrome followed by lower respiratory symptoms) is what defines bronchiolitis 1
- Do not order tests to "rule out" other diagnoses in typical presentations—this increases costs and leads to overtreatment 1, 2
- Do not assume fever indicates bacterial infection—fever alone does not justify antibiotics, as serious bacterial infection risk is less than 1% in older infants with bronchiolitis 2
- Serial clinical observations may be needed as the physical examination reflects variability in disease state over time 1
